The car was originally ordered as a municipality vehicle for a city in Aichi Prefecture. The city used it for visiting officials from 1984-2011. In 2011, the car went up for auction and sat for months until a DoD employee here in Misawa made an offer. After some negotiating, he was able to get the vehicle for cheaper than expected and planned on adding it to his collection of automobiles stateside. Unfortunately, he ran into some issues and was considering selling the car. Ironically, when he was trying to decide to keep/sell the car, I happened to see him parking one day and had the usual car talk. I had no intentions to own such a car but just out of the spontaneous idea of "I've never owned something like this," I asked him if he was planning on selling it. This was October 2012. After months of emails and phone calls, he finally let me purchase the car May 17th for an astoundingly low price. Here are a few specs:

1984 Toyota Century VG40
16,000 km
Power locks
Power windows
Power wing mirrors
Power trunk lid
Auto dimming headlights
Self adjusting hydraulic rear suspension
Dual audio control
Dual climate control
Column shift auto
4.0 liter V8
Digital tachometer
Horizontal speedometer
Power reclining rear seats
Power massaging rear seats
Rear folding reading lamp
7 layers of black paint
Hand built made to order only
Japanese Royal Family's vehicle of choice

I have already added a few of my personal touches but have a few more plans. So far:
Espilar lowering springs (approximately 2" drop)
Junction Produce taillights
Junction Produce fender indicator lenses
Removed the seat covers
